DUTIES
Your duties as the Business Change Partner include:
• Stakeholder Partnership: Building strong relationships with sponsors, leaders, and stakeholders across the organisation
• Change Impact Assessment: Assessing the impact of change on people, roles, processes, and ways of working
• Change Planning: Developing and delivering change management plans covering communication, engagement, training, and adoption
• Leadership Support: Acting as a trusted advisor to leaders, supporting them to lead and embed change effectively
• Process Improvement: Defining, evaluating, and improving business processes to support readiness and benefits realisation
• Engagement & Communication: Designing and delivering engaging communications and activities to support understanding and confidence
• Facilitation: Leading workshops and meetings to gather feedback, address concerns, and build shared understanding
• Training Support: Supporting the design and delivery of training, user guides, FAQs, and support materials
• Collaboration: Working closely with the Business Change Manager and project teams to align change activity with delivery plans
• Monitoring & Reporting: Tracking adoption, progress, and outcomes, adapting plans to maximise effectiveness
